📌 Overview

A threat actor operating under the alias omg786 has posted a listing on a dark web forum claiming to have leaked over 990,000 records tied to Argentinian driver licenses, allegedly involving 364,000 unique individuals. The dataset is offered in SQLite format (.db) and is bundled with two local Flask APIs in both English and Spanish. The actor also claims the leak includes comprehensive identity and driving record information, including class, issuance/expiration dates, issuing locations, and notes like medical restrictions.
